Concrete lifting services are designed to restore uneven or sunken concrete slabs to their proper level. This process typically involves injecting specialized materials beneath the affected area to raise and stabilize the concrete. It offers a non-invasive alternative to replacing entire slabs, making it a practical solution for homeowners and property managers seeking to improve safety and curb appeal without extensive demolition. The goal is to achieve a smooth, level surface that can support foot traffic, vehicles, or outdoor furniture, enhancing both functionality and appearance.

One of the primary issues concrete lifting addresses is uneven or settled slabs that can create tripping hazards or cause damage to vehicles and property. Over time, soil movement, erosion, or the natural settling of foundations can lead to concrete surfaces becoming uneven or cracked. Lifting and leveling these surfaces helps prevent further deterioration, reduces the risk of accidents, and can extend the lifespan of existing concrete structures. This service is especially valuable in areas like driveways, sidewalks, patios, and pool decks, where safety and aesthetics are important.

Discover typical Concrete Lifting project ranges for Murrells Inlet, SC.

Cost Range - Concrete lifting services typically cost between $500 and $2,500 per project, depending on the size and extent of the area. For example, small residential slabs may be closer to $500, while larger driveways can approach $2,500 or more.

Factors Affecting Price - The overall cost varies based on the complexity of the lift, access to the site, and the amount of material needed. Additional services like crack repair or surface leveling may increase the total cost.

Average Cost per Square Foot - Many providers charge between $3 and $8 per square foot for concrete lifting. For instance, a 500-square-foot driveway might range from $1,500 to $4,000.

Regional Variations - Prices can fluctuate depending on local market rates and contractor availability in Murrells Inlet, SC, and nearby areas. Contact local service providers for precise estimates tailored to specific projects.

What is concrete lifting? Concrete lifting is a process that raises and levels sunken or uneven concrete slabs, restoring their original position and improving safety and appearance.

How do professionals lift settled concrete? Local service providers typically use specialized equipment like polyurethane foam or mudjacking to lift and stabilize concrete surfaces efficiently.

Is concrete lifting suitable for all types of concrete damage? Concrete lifting is most effective for settling, sinking, or uneven slabs; it may not be appropriate for severely cracked or damaged concrete that requires replacement.

How long does concrete lifting typically take? The duration varies depending on the size and number of slabs, but many projects can be completed within a few hours to a day.

What are the benefits of concrete lifting? Concrete lifting can improve safety, enhance curb appeal, prevent further damage, and extend the lifespan of existing concrete surfaces.
